Now with the current situation with Keycaps
Let me start with the timeline since the Kickstarter campaign.
- The KS campaign ended mid
Jan'17
-
July'17, the mold made by our partner produced V shaped keys. An error in the design that went through.
Our partner had to make new molds of course.
- Between
Sept'17 & Aug'18 we went into language layouts and countless labels iterations
It is also Aug'18 we decided to deliver keycaps on a plastic panel, instead of delivering in a simple plastic bag.
-
Sept'18, Batch#1 mass production started for all US/DE/FR/UK layouts in White/Black/CD32 theme and Transparent sets.
We decided to produce in two batches, as to produce all colors would have taken way more additional time.
Retrospectively now, I am glad we decided on this. At the time we weren't aware of the misprints yet so it gave us a change to replace your wrongly printed keys in fact.
-
Jan'19, Batch#1 Merchandise is on board and sailing toward our UK warehouse.
-
Feb'19/(19/20), Batch#1 keys reached warehouse and dispatch to contributors starts.
The same week we dispatch the keys, we are realizing that several boxes of full black sets and translucent sets had issues.. we could not send those sadly.
At the same time we are receiving feedback from backers informing us that some of their keys had misprinted labels...
It was quickly understood we had to replace those, and so we did.
(at this point, some of you are still waiting for replacement keys. But this is normal since we need those to be manufactured.. and we're currently waiting).
We replaced a total of around 1200 keys (as in single keys. not full sets.)
It was also decided we had to fix this label printing issues with the printing manufacturer.
(They are two factories, one injects the keys, another one prints them. Keycaps are transported in between).
- From
June'19 to Dec'19, we've built the remaining language layout panels for printing, and we've also fixed all the printing issues we got from contributors feedback from Batch#1.
Also, in
Oct'19 we were present at Amiga'34 to display the latest keycaps sample at the time including the new German layout.
- End
Dec'19 we were waiting for our manufacturers to inform us on the mass production schedule for Batch#2.
- After Christmas and New year festivities, Mid Jan'20 I was informed from our PM that we'd had to wait a week more as she couldn't share any timeline with us within the week and that we should wait the following week.
- End
Jan'20, we got the news about the pandemic which had hit China at first of course.
At this point of time, you have to understand we're most probably the tiniest customers for those factories.
I live in Singapore as some of you might know. My neighbors who have family in China did not had any news for weeks..
== From this very point in time, both project are at full stop! Keycaps and A500 Cases.
- In
March'20, we informed contributors through the campaign update page that we didn't had anything in sight regarding when our keycaps could be manufactured. Curiously, we had the feeling the A500 case project might somewhat kinda move a bit in a not too distant future.. (well, that started to happen in September'20!)
- Fast forward to
Sept'20; A quick chat with our two PMs in CN, and we understood that when the time comes we'd have a chance to produce keycaps, it would be best for us to have less colors to avoid being pushed back even further. We understood the reason why this was gently suggested (in a chinese way).
For each color change, molds and press needs to be cleaned inside out. It takes 3 to 4 days.
Having less colors and they'd agree to produce our keycaps as soon as possible.
In the meantime, and this is important to understand, the printing factory which is usually manufacturing parts for pharma, turns its lines to covid support.
At the very same time CN government is requesting for hundreds of factories and companies to support the effort.
However,
with the reduction of colors we now know that injecting the keycaps will be way swifter than before, and this is where all the team thanks you again guys because this will actually be of help when production time arrives in a few weeks or couple months from now.
Also,
Sept'20 is when we got news from our PM in UK informing us that A500 case project will be able to slowly move again. At the time, the CnC prototype was waiting on a cupboard since January for the fitting tests to be done!
In the mean time we didn't any info yet about keycaps production and when it could happen.
We only knew that with less colors we'd be able to manufacture faster, so that label printer also get them faster.
- Oct/Nov/Dec'20 - We received quite few updates and nothing new really. We knew we were waiting and the time would come. Also in the meantime the pandemic started to pic up again in europe.
As I said earlier, I live in Asia and my borders are closed since Jan'20. No one can come in nor go out.
(Today May'21, this is still the case).
- Jan/Feb/March'21 - We got news that one of the production line will be retrofitted to attend to conventional customers.
This is good news, since we're in this group!
- We're now May'21 and we're now on the queue. Alas, we can't yet communicate any ETA for now. None were communicated to us. The only thing I know is that it moves and Keycaps are almost visible from where I stand.

I understand some of you might still not understand why we need to wait a bit more. Or why we haven't decided to work with another factory for the labels etc..
The thing is that its not that easy to change and move to another factory.
When we've done all those label printing tests, our PMs in China got few samples from a couple other factories.
I can assure you guys don't want to see the results. The tests we've done were laser etching and dye sublimation.
Seing the bad test results (shared through campaign updates as well), we went back to pad printing and stayed with current partner.
Also, we can't move all pad printing tooling to another factory as everything is custom and would generate additional costs.
The other hidden "cost" lies in the experience any other factory wouldn't have with our keycaps as these since our set is all custom too.
